Transaction 2e307e618c540f99659015250d2b4fbda26ed9d821437ebbd41a0b5f2d7fc7a7
1 Input
2 Outputs
- 2e307e618c540f99659015250d2b4fbda26ed9d821437ebbd41a0b5f2d7fc7a7:0
- 2e307e618c540f99659015250d2b4fbda26ed9d821437ebbd41a0b5f2d7fc7a7:1
value 582042
address 3GgvnXW9TkUaruTR6HAQsjKttswA4jt2r4
value 7140562
address 1Q9vZAVMqENy1GZcyyVsHw1CPTkE1DBC1C